Celestine

Celestine is the story of two young lovers in the bustling military city of Townsville at the height of the Vietnam war. There’s the French girl, charming, witty Celestine Benoir from the off-beat Bistro Paradis, and Nick Finlay, an ambitious local newspaper reporter.

But on a bright October day in 1966, Air Force One touches down in the northern city after a late change to US President Lyndon Johnson’s plans for his visit to Australia. The unforeseen consequences are dramatic, frightening and high risk. For Celestine and Nick, their idyllic love haven is shattered.

National security agents close in as dark secrets from Celestine’s past emerge to put the lovers’ lives at risk and drive their belief in one another to breaking point.

Celestine is available as an audio book and negotiations are open for its hard copy publication and adaptation to the big screen, TV or streaming.

A second novel by Russ Morgan, titled Sleepers, is now well advanced. As well, a book of memoirs titled ‘Vantage Points’ covers his life and wide ranging behind-the-scenes experiences as a reporter and foreign correspondent.
